Les meilleurs scripts PHP en 2020 : Formulaire de contact ultime pour PHP, HTML5 et AJAX

0
179
Formulaire de contact ultime pour PHP, HTML5 et AJAX - 1

Voir la démoAcheter $11

Télécharger le script

Présentation de notre formulaire de contact ultime

Ce nouveau formulaire remplace nos formulaires précédents et regroupe tous leurs meilleurs éléments en un seul produit facile à installer et à gérer.

Démo en direct

Vous pouvez visionner une démonstration en direct en cliquant sur «Aperçu en direct» sous l’image du produit.

Remarque:

Vous ne recevrez pas d’e-mail (les e-mails vont à l’administrateur du site, pas aux utilisateurs).
Comme il s’agit d’une démo, l’e-mail ne va nulle part, mais vous verrez quels commentaires l’utilisateur recevra.

Liste des fonctionnalités

  • Intégration / instructions faciles dans votre site PHP actuel
  • Progressivement amélioré (entièrement fonctionnel sans JS ou CSS)
  • Validation du type de champ (HTML, secours javascript avec sauvegarde PHP)
  • Validation de champ obligatoire
  • Plusieurs formulaires par page sont autorisés
  • Jolies boîtes de sélection
  • Répéter la prévention des soumissions
  • Prévention des attaques Cross Site Scripting (XSS)
  • Aucune base de données requise
  • Option SMTP disponible (la valeur par défaut est le mail de PHP ())
  • Traductions via un simple fichier JSON
  • AJAX activé (aucun rechargement de page)
  • Animations CSS sur la messagerie et le champ actif
  • Google invisible reCAPTCHA
  • Adapté aux mobiles
  • Prise en charge des téléchargements de fichiers à joindre à un e-mail
  • Plusieurs adresses «envoyer à» lors de la soumission
  • Redirection de page personnalisée de succès facultative
  • Code extrêmement propre et bien commenté

Formulaire de contact ultime pour PHP, HTML5 et AJAX - 2

Prise en charge des serveurs et des navigateurs

  • PHP5 +
  • IE10 +
  • Derniers Chrome, Firefox, Safari

FAQ

J’héberge avec 123-reg et mon formulaire ne fonctionnera pas

Nous utilisons CURL pour récupérer le contenu du fichier Translations.json, cependant 123-reg n’autorise pas l’utilisation de CURL pour la récupération de fichier «même serveur». Nous supposons qu’il s’agit d’une mesure de sécurité trop prudente. C’est une solution relativement simple (c’est une ligne de code), alors ne laissez pas cela vous décourager d’acheter le formulaire.

Support et rapport de bogue

Ici à Jigowatt, nous essayons de produire les meilleurs produits que nous pouvons en vente sur Envato.

Si vous rencontrez un problème avec notre produit, nous voulons le savoir immédiatement.

Si vous avez trouvé un bogue légitime dans notre code, nous le corrigerons en temps opportun et mettrons à jour le produit.
Si nous nous souvenons, nous vous créditerons également de l’avoir trouvé.

Si vous rencontrez des problèmes pour faire fonctionner le produit ou si vous avez modifié le code, nous pouvons vous aider, mais cela peut être facturé 60 £ / h.

La raison en est que le produit coûte moins d’une heure du temps de nos développeurs et que nous devons couvrir nos coûts.

Merci de votre compréhension.

Suivez-nous sur Twitter

Mises à jour

03.05.19 - v2.0.4 - FIX: jQuery tweak for setting recaptcha token
02.05.19 - v2.0.3 - UPDATE: recaptcha hidden field added and JS tweak
25.04.19 - v2.0.2 - UPDATE: Set <HTML lang> attribute to override translation.json default_lang
18.04.19 - v2.0.1 - UPDATE: Removed 'personality' from translation texts
                    ADDED: CSRF improvements
                    ADDED: reCAPTCHA spam score link added to email
                    FIX: reCAPTCHA JavaScript not submitting it’s response value correctly to process.php
                    FIX: Corrected file exists detection before attaching to mail
22.11.18 - v2.0.0 - WARNING: THIS RELEASE INTRODUCES BREAKING CHANGES
                    UPDATE: PHPMailer upgraded from v5.2.22 to v6.0.5
                    UPDATE: Google reCAPTCHA upgraded from v2 to v3
                    UPDATE: Documentation update for common questions and issues
                    ADDED: IP address of user added to sent email (optional)
                    REMOVE: Honeypot hidden field and validation removed
                    FIX: cURL incorrectly returning NULL in some cases
                    FIX: International phone numbers now permitted (removed numeric validation)

22.02.17 - v1.0.8 - UPDATE: email format now includes all form data by default
                    UPDATE: translation tweaks
                    ADDED: keep files on server after email is sent (uses server space)
                    FIX: styling for reCaptcha to display reliably on smaller screens
                    FIX: better error reporting when reCaptcha has an empty response
                    FIX: reset google captcha upon failed submission to pass validation

18.01.17 - v1.0.7 - FIX: now deletes uploads when page redirect is set
                    FIX: added check for recaptcha before reset attempt
                    FIX: PHP undefined $protocol variable notice
                    FIX: Spelling mistake in translations.json

30.06.16 - v1.0.6 - upgraded "select2" to fix "focusable" console error
                  - fixed potential issue with multiple forms in the page (which aren't ucf)

12.03.16 - v1.0.5 - fixed BCC field variable name typo from "address" to "addresses" 

12.11.15 - v1.0.4 - fixed issue where recaptcha didn't reset when reset button clicked

11.11.15 - v1.0.3 - fixed issue where internal cURL requests were denied by servers
                  - fixed issue with Google reCaptcha session timeouts
                  - added form field reset button after form successfully submits
                  - added option to send a confirmation email (off by default)

26.06.15 - v1.0.2 - use email "subject" translation instead of "intro" 
                  - correctly use "from" name in the email output
                  - fixed check for servers that have cURL, but don't allow it to run

13.05.15 - v1.0.1 - Added Google reCaptcha blog to readme
                  - Added UTF8 character support in emails (thanks asterix_jv)
                  - MS Word document upload support (thanks brewbuddy)
                  - Added BCC functionality/option (thanks macisbac)
                  - Added CURL support (thanks ihutch)

01.01.15 - v1.0.0 - Released for public sale

LAISSER UN COMMENTAIRE

S'il vous plaît entrez votre commentaire!
S'il vous plaît entrez votre nom ici